Topping and Tailing Tips

You don’t need to bath your baby every day, although it is a good way to relax them as they get a little older and establish more of a routine. Topping and tailing – washing the important bits – is often enough in those early, sleep deprived days!

Choose a time when your baby is awake and contented and make sure the room is warm. Get everything ready beforehand. You’ll need a bowl of warm water, a towel, cotton wool, a fresh nappy and, if necessary, clean clothes.

Hold your baby on your knee or lay them on a changing mat. Take off all their clothes, apart from their vest and nappy, and wrap them in a towel.

Dip the cotton wool in the water (make sure it doesn’t get too wet) and wipe gently around your baby’s eyes from the nose outward, using a fresh piece of cotton wool for each eye. This is so that you don’t transfer any stickiness or infection from one eye to another.

Use a fresh piece of cotton wool to clean around your baby’s ears, but not inside them. Never use cotton buds to clean inside your baby’s ears. Wash the rest of your baby’s face, neck and hands in the same way and dry them gently with the towel.

Take off the nappy and wash your baby’s bits with fresh cotton wool and warm water. Dry very carefully, including between the skin folds, and put on a clean nappy.

It will help your baby to relax if you keep talking while you wash them. The more they hear your voice, the more they’ll get used to listening to you and start to understand what you’re saying.

Advice on how to wash and bath your baby

Advice on how to wash and bath your baby

Washing and bathing your baby for the first time can be a little scary especially when your baby gets upset when being undressed and immersed in water. So below are a few answers to some common questions. We hope they help to make bath times less stressful and, hopefully in time, more fun!

How often should I bath my baby?
The general feeling is that you don’t have to bath your baby every day, twice or three times a week would be fine. But with much of the advice we give, it’s really up to you and your baby.

What is ‘Topping and tailing’?
What you do need to do on a daily basis is wash your baby’s face, neck, hands and bottom. This is sometimes referred to as ‘topping and tailing’.
Topping and tailing can be done on a changing mat or your lap. Make sure the room is warm and that your baby isn’t in a draft. Choose the right time to wash your baby, don’t bath your little one after a feed or when they are hungry or sleepy. The best time to bath your baby is when they are wide awake and contented.
For topping and tailing you will need a bowl of warm water, some cotton wool, a towel and a fresh nappy. Make sure the water is warm and not hot. It’s important when topping and tailing always to use fresh piece of cotton wool for each body part. For newborns it is also important to clean around the baby’s navel. For advice on keeping the navel clean and dry please ask your midwife.
